Every IP address that is exposed to the public Internet is unique. In contrast, IP addresses within a local network use the same private addresses; thus, a user's computer in company A can have the same address as a user in company B and thousands of other companies. However, private IP addresses are not reachable from the outside world (see private IP address).
Logical Vs. Physical
An IP address is a logical address that is assigned by software residing in a server or router (see DHCP). In order to locate a device in the network, the logical IP address is converted to a physical address by a function within the TCP/IP protocol software (see ARP). The physical address is actually built into the hardware (see MAC address).
Static and Dynamic IP
Network infrastructure devices such as servers, routers and firewalls are typically assigned permanent "static" IP addresses. The client machines can also be assigned static IPs by a network administrator, but most often are automatically assigned temporary "dynamic" IP addresses via software that uses the "dynamic host configuration protocol" (see DHCP). Cable and DSL modems typically use dynamic IP with a new IP address assigned to the modem each time it is rebooted.
The Dotted Decimal Address: x.x.x.x
IP addresses are written in "dotted decimal" notation, which is four sets of numbers separated by decimal points; for example, 204.171.64.2. Instead of the domain name of a Web site, the actual IP address can be entered into the browser. However, the Domain Name System (DNS) exists so users can enter computerlanguage.com instead of an IP address, and the domain (the URL) computerlanguage.com is converted to the numeric IP address (see DNS).
Although the next version of the IP protocol offers essentially an unlimited number of unique IP addresses (see IPv6), the traditional IP addressing system (IPv4) uses a smaller 32-bit number that is split between the network and host (client, server, etc.). The host part can be further divided into subnetworks (see subnet mask).
Class A, B and C
Based on the split of the 32 bits, an IP address is either Class A, B or C, the most common of which is Class C. More than two million Class C addresses are assigned, quite often in large blocks to network access providers for use by their customers. The fewest are Class A networks, which are reserved for government agencies and huge companies.
Although people identify the class by the first number in the IP address (see table below), a computer identifies class by the first three bits of the IP address (A=0; B=10; C=110). This class system has also been greatly expanded, eliminating the huge disparity in the number of hosts that each class can accommodate (see CIDR). See private IP address and IP.
NETWORKS VERSUS HOSTS IN IPV4 IP ADDRESSES
Maximum Maximum Number of
Class Number Hosts Bits used in
Number of per Network/Host
Class Range Networks Network ID ID
A 1-126 127 16,777,214 7/24
B 128-191 16,383 65,534 14/16
C 192-223 2,097,151 254 21/8
127 reserved for loopback test
Networks, Subnets and Hosts
An IP address is first divided between networks and hosts. The host bits are further divided between subnets and hosts. See subnet mask.
![]() | Reproduced with permission from Computer Desktop Encyclopedia. Copyright (c) 1981-2009 The Computer Language Company Inc. All rights reserved. |
Additional Resources
- What the Google Privacy Dashboard can mean for health
- I'm with the "Oh noes".Giving an advertising company access to all my health data just so I can find out if someone like, say, an advertising company has access to it, strikes me as a bit of on own goal.Trust Google with more data?Google already has- my IP address- my...
- Discussion threads 2009-11-05
- No-IP Dynamic DNS Update Client 3.1.3b4 (Mac)
- The No-IP Dynamic Update client sits in the back ground and monitors your dynamic IP address. Whenever it changes it sends up update to our system to update your No-IP.com account DNS host names. The client supports multiple hosts, group updates and also runs as a daemon running in the...
- Software downloads 2009-11-03
- Protection 1.5 (Mac)
- Protection is an anti theft software with a lot of possibilities: iSight capture, screen capture, data hiding on the stolen Mac Protection sends all this information including IP address of the thief on a server and you'll be able to track the thief around the world. Don't be scared of...
- Software downloads 2009-11-03
- Scaring yourself and others
- Hogwash!First of all, if you're paying for a static IP address, why did your ISP change it? Did the notify you prior to changing it? If not, they can get in deep trouble for that.Second, on today's hardware using virtualization causes little to no noticeable performance hit. ...
- Discussion threads 2009-10-31
- Apple Airport Extreme Base Station (Winter 2009)
- Great Performance With Some AnnoyancesI got this wireless router because my D-Link one had become unreliable. I opened the box and this router is beautiful, packaged in typical Apple style, although it didn't setup in typical style, and in fact it was a nightmare to setup.This router doesn't use...
- Discussion threads 2009-10-28
- Real Hide IP 3.5.3.2 (Windows)
- Real Hide IP is easy-to-use privacy software which allows you to conceal your IP address, choose IP country and surf anonymously. It can clear cookies, protect your privacy, prevent identity theft, and guard against hacker intrusions, all with the click of a button. Using it, you can conceal your identity...
- Software downloads 2009-10-28
- FacsBridge T37FSP 3.0.2 (Windows)
- facsBridge T37FSP is a Windows fax driver that bridges the gap between Internet Fax Gateway and Windows Fax Service, so that you can enjoy intuitive and easy to use Windows desktop faxing. The product provides native Windows Fax Service / Windows Fax Printer integration with 3rd party Internet Fax Service...
- Software downloads 2009-10-27
- TP-Link TL-WR741ND Wireless Lite N Router
- At less than $40, the TP-Link TL-WR741ND Wireless Lite N Router is among the cheapest 802.11n routers, if not the cheapest, you can find on the market. It's also the first we've reviewed that supports the single-stream standard and therefore caps at only 150Mbps hence the Lite designation. Other Wireless-N...
- Product reviews 2009-10-26
- IP Hider 4.7 (Windows)
- IP Hider is a privacy protection tool that mask your IP address preventing your surfing habits and your internet activity form being tracked by websites or Internet Service Providers. IP Hider is blocking invasive codes that may harm or use inadvertently information on your computer, and provides a good online...
- Software downloads 2009-10-26
- Send Mail Expert 1.3 (Windows)
- Send Mail Expert can control randomize: From name, From emails, Subjects, Reply to, Proxy, IP address, Email Header, Email Body. All such randomization will guarantee that your email will bypass all the filters (Junk Mail Filter, Block List...) and delivered safely to your customers. Send Mail Expert offers you a...
- Software downloads 2009-10-23
- SIMCommander AntiVirus Analyzer 3.1.4 (Windows)
- SIMCommander K-SOC Analyzer uses a new approach to analyze virus information from different point products and expands the existing AntiVirus visibility in a dashboard. The K-SOC Analyzer dashboard is a high-level snapshot of your AntiVirus activity that can quickly and easily visualize the AntiVirus status of your network relative to...
- Software downloads 2009-10-23
- Gaping security hole in Time Warner cable routers
- how about telling us how to fix it?Can the customer log into their own router and change the vulnerable settings? Please advise.Patetic simply pateticThis is a worst case scenario... Time Warner is guilty of having used the same Admin Name/Password on all their routers and from what I read on...
- Discussion threads 2009-10-22
- IPMaster 1.5 (Windows)
- IPMaster is IP address management software. It provides visual IP address assignment network topology tree, automatic subnet calculation, mask calculation, subnetting, network segment scanning, host monitoring, ping, traceroute, telnet, and netsend. It supports VLSM and CIDR. The purpose of this software is to assign and manage IP address efficiently for...
- Software downloads 2009-10-22
- MintDNS Enterprise 2.0 (Windows)
- MintDNS 2006 Enterprise is a fully featured server suite that allows you to run your own enterprise level DDNS Server. Providing both Dynamic and Static DNS services MintDNS supports standard update protocols which enables support for many third party IP address update clients. Including many of the hardware clients found...
- Software downloads 2009-10-22
- Global cyberwar: Installed in your PC at home, the office and government
- Personal Accountabilityas long as people can think and act as though their conduct on the internet is shrouded in anonomity.Until each of us takes full responsibility for what we do and operates with the knowledge that our 'unique' verifiable identities can be obtained readily, the carnage will continue and broaden.A...
- Discussion threads 2009-10-21
- IP LanTracker 1.2 (Windows)
- IP LanTracker enables users of home network routers to monitor their IP addresses and provide notifications on change. IP LanTracker provides both FTP and email SMTP with SSL for notifications. IP LanTracker also provides the ability to change the users IP address at preset time intervals via the router interface....
- Software downloads 2009-10-21
- NetSetMan 2.6.2 (Windows)
- NetSetMan is a network settings manager which can easily switch between 6 different profiles including IP address, subnet mask, default gateway, DNS server, Win server, computer name, printer, DNS domain, workgroup, and scripts. It also can get current settings and do a FastSwitch from the tray bar. With only two...
- Software downloads 2009-10-21
- OneClick 2.0.7 (Windows)
- OneClick allows you to create customized auto-reconnecting remote support customer modules that allow you to see and operate the remote computer in real-time over an encrypted connection, type commands, control the mouse, transfer files, reboot into safe mode, run as a system service to allow logon/logoff. The optional Web configuration...
- Software downloads 2009-10-21
- Ad Muncher 4.8 (Windows)
- Ad Muncher is a powerful advert and popup blocking system for all browsers and advert-displaying programs like ICQ, Morpheus, Kazaa, Grokster, Opera, PalTalk, iMesh, Bearshare, LimeWire, etc. Ad Muncher can be configured to block anything that annoys you, with simple options to block common annoyances like: - Music and sound...
- Software downloads 2009-10-21
- HP's Hurd: Cloud computing has its limits (especially when you face 1,000 attacks a day)
- Now here's a ringing endorsement of cloud computing......"HP "wouldn?t put anything material in nature outside the firewall." "Sure gives one confidence, doesn't it? And this company is trying sell people on the cloud...but its CEO doesn't trust it? Nice. :-(Translation: We make a lot of money selling overpriced, under utilizedservers...
- Discussion threads 2009-10-20
Neighboring Terms
Premier Vendor Content Whitepapers, webcasts & resources from our Power Center Sponsors
SmartPlanet
- Thought-provoking progressive ideas on diverse topics that intersect with technology, business, and life, and matter to the world at large. Visit SmartPlanet
- More from IBM
- How to Drive Better Business Outcomes with Exceptional Web Experiences Download the eBook
- Driving Business Agility through SOA Connectivity & Integration Read the White Paper from IBM
- Linking Decisions and Information for Organizational Performance Read the Tom Davenport study



